Life is comparable to many things, including a ship’s voyage to paradise.

​​

​During our journey, we often experience sunny days and smooth sailing, much like the pleasant moments in life. However, there are also dark and stormy days that both a ship and we must navigate through as we strive toward our final destination.

​

In John 16:33 Jesus forewarns us, “In this world you will have trouble”, but also follows up by reassuring us to, “Take heart! I have overcome the world.”

​

Throughout life's trials and tribulations, we can find comfort in Isaiah 43:2 and 41:10 which state, “When you pass through the waters, I will be with you; and when you pass through the rivers, they will not sweep over you. So do not fear, for I am with you; do not be dismayed, for I am your God. I will strengthen you and help you; I will uphold you with my righteous right hand.”

​

We all experience many moments of pain and suffering throughout our livesDuring those times it's important to remember that we are not alone. We can always turn to our faith for comfort and guidance and "Cast our cares on the Lord because he will sustain us and he will never let the righteous be shaken." as Psalms 55:22 advises.

 

We must always remember that our time on earth is temporary and fleeting. Those who have faith in Jesus can find solace in knowing that their ultimate destination is an eternity in a peaceful paradise free from sorrow, pain, and suffering. Therefore, we should live our lives with unwavering purpose and faith knowing that our final destination is guaranteed.

​

In Luke 23:42-43 states that when the thief being crucified next to Jesus said, "Jesus remember me when you come into your kingdom.", Jesus replied, "Truly I tell you, today you will be with me in paradise." This powerful exchange serves as a reminder of the ultimate reward for those who believe in Jesus.

 

As we go through life, let us hold fast to this promise and trust in Jesus, knowing that our eternal home awaits us after we exhale our final breath on Earth. With faith and perseverance, we too can experience the joy and fulfillment of everlasting paradise - a place of pure peace and contentment that surpasses all understanding.
